Busy day in the cold.
Email Print RSS Facebook Twitter RSS

By LIEUTENANT Charles Cunningham
February 29, 2020

Saturday February 29th was a very busy day for Pinch Fire. In the pre dawn hours Pinch Fire was alerted to a working residential structure fire. Throughout the rest of the day we also responded to several other incidents. One of which was a automobile accident with entrapment.

As night fell, we were alerted to a second working structure fire & was assisted by Clendenin and Frame VFDs in shuttling water.

Of the seven auto accidents no one was seriously injured. Everyone returned safely after the calls.

Units: Engine 21, 22, 23. Squad 2 & Utility 25
 
Mutual Aid: Sissionville, Malden, Clendenin & Frame Volunteer Fire Depts., Kanawha Co. Ambulance, Kanawha Co. Sheriff Office.
